Prices Projected To Rise More Slowly Over 5 Years Graph - Hunterdon + Somerset County, NJ Residential Real Estate

Some markets are seeing home prices flatten or dip slightly right now. But over the next 5 years, national price growth is expected to rise overall, just at a slower pace than we’ve seen in years past. And that’s not a sign of a crash. Over 100 housing experts agree: nationally, home prices are expected to keep going up through 2029, just at a more moderate rate. And that’s a good thing.
